From bab9e77c87d3b596e77d669b0a827b50e725bb62 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
|
||||
From: Ilya Pronin <ipronin@twitter.com>
|
||||
Date: Fri, 3 Apr 2020 20:00:37 -0700
|
||||
Subject: [PATCH] route/link: add RTNL_LINK_REASM_OVERLAPS stat
|
||||
|
||||
The new stat exposes IPSTATS_MIB_REASM_OVERLAPS link stat. However, the
|
||||
original motivation for this change was fixing the issue with missing RX
|
||||
packets link stat.
|
||||
|
||||
The regression was introduced in version 3.5.0 with commit 73c1d047,
|
||||
that added a new enum constant IPSTATS_MIB_REASM_OVERLAPS. Without this
|
||||
patch, IPSTATS_MIB_REASM_OVERLAPS is missing from
|
||||
map_stat_id_from_IPSTATS_MIB_v2 and is mapped by it to 0. This tricks
|
||||
inet6_parse_protinfo() into erroneously overwriting RTNL_LINK_RX_PACKETS
|
||||
stat, which happens to have value 0, when it tries to set
|
||||
IPSTATS_MIB_REASM_OVERLAPS.
|
||||
|
||||
Fixes: 73c1d0479643 ('Sync linux headers to 4.19.66')
|
||||
|
||||
https://github.com/thom311/libnl/pull/235
